Output 2158332aae33e1669da2b1636ed4d818e8aa1784f595708e4b0c000b679ea202:0

value
55864
script pubkey
OP_0 OP_PUSHBYTES_20 de21a3162c702e8a15ec0402b8bc14e316aed915
address
bc1qmcs6x93vwqhg590vqspt30q5uvt2akg4mtrnm0
transaction
2158332aae33e1669da2b1636ed4d818e8aa1784f595708e4b0c000b679ea202
confirmations
6514
spent
true